Output 128426b78b76e6733b7b4ddc2f796578694aeb188cb9c9a6c18b4a5150d721a2:5

value
27922485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 107fadb1743e19e877b8c2e3f9feb252229ae7d0 OP_EQUAL
address
M9QPzkppu3a5yr3hPepsUmx8KsM6S8aFLS
transaction
128426b78b76e6733b7b4ddc2f796578694aeb188cb9c9a6c18b4a5150d721a2
spent
true